What Is a Men’s Health Checkup?
A men's health checkup is a preventive medical assessment designed to identify potential health risks and monitor important aspects of male health.
Depending on the clinic and individual needs, it may include:
- General medical consultation
- Blood pressure measurement
- Weight and BMI assessment
- Blood testing
- Blood glucose testing
- Cholesterol testing
- Liver and kidney function testing
- Urinary evaluation
- Prostate-related assessment when appropriate
- Lifestyle counseling
- Additional screening based on age and risk factors
Not every man requires every test.

Blood Pressure Screening
Blood pressure is one of the most basic parts of preventive healthcare.
High blood pressure may not cause obvious symptoms, so regular measurement can help identify a potential problem.
If readings are repeatedly elevated, further medical evaluation may be recommended.
Cholesterol Testing
Cholesterol testing can help assess cardiovascular risk.
A blood test may include measurements such as:
- Total cholesterol
- LDL cholesterol
- HDL cholesterol
- Triglycerides
The results should be interpreted alongside other risk factors rather than viewed independently.
Blood Sugar Testing
Blood glucose screening may help identify diabetes or elevated blood sugar.
Depending on the situation, a doctor may recommend:
- Fasting blood glucose
- HbA1c
- Other tests when appropriate
Men with family history, overweight, high blood pressure, or other risk factors may need closer monitoring.
Liver Function Testing
Liver health can be affected by several factors, including:
- Alcohol
- Certain medications
- Metabolic conditions
- Viral infections
- Fat accumulation in the liver
Blood testing may help identify abnormalities that require further evaluation.
Kidney Health Screening
Kidney function can be monitored through appropriate blood and urine tests.
Kidney health becomes particularly relevant for men with:
- High blood pressure
- Diabetes
- Family history of kidney disease
- Certain medication use
- Previous kidney problems
Additional evaluation may be recommended if results are abnormal.
Urinary Health
Urinary symptoms can occur for many reasons.
Men may seek evaluation for:
- Frequent urination
- Urgency
- Weak urine stream
- Difficulty starting urination
- Pain during urination
- Blood in urine
- Nighttime urination
Persistent urinary symptoms should receive appropriate medical assessment.
Prostate Health
Prostate health becomes increasingly relevant with age.
A doctor may ask about:
- Urinary symptoms
- Family history
- Previous prostate problems
- Age-related risk factors
Depending on individual circumstances, further prostate evaluation may be recommended.
A prostate-specific antigen test, commonly called a PSA test, is not automatically necessary for every man. Discuss its potential benefits and limitations with a healthcare professional.
Men’s Sexual Health
A comprehensive men's health consultation may also provide an opportunity to discuss private concerns.
These can include:
- Erectile difficulties
- Reduced sexual desire
- Premature ejaculation
- Fertility concerns
- Sexual infections
- Hormonal concerns
Men should feel comfortable discussing these issues because they can sometimes be associated with broader health conditions.
Testosterone Testing
Testosterone levels may be evaluated when symptoms suggest a possible hormonal issue.
Possible symptoms can include:
- Reduced sexual desire
- Erectile problems
- Reduced energy
- Changes in muscle mass
- Mood changes
Testosterone testing should be interpreted in the context of symptoms and appropriate clinical evaluation.
Men’s Health and Heart Disease
Cardiovascular health is an important part of preventive care.
Risk factors can include:
- High blood pressure
- High cholesterol
- Diabetes
- Smoking
- Obesity
- Physical inactivity
- Family history
A general health checkup can help identify several of these risk factors.
Men’s Health and Weight Management
Excess body weight can be associated with several health conditions.
A men's health assessment may include:
- Weight
- BMI
- Waist circumference
- Blood pressure
- Blood glucose
- Cholesterol
If weight is a concern, the doctor may recommend nutrition and lifestyle support.
Smoking and Men's Health
Smoking increases the risk of multiple health problems.
Men who smoke may benefit from discussing smoking cessation during their health checkup.
A doctor can provide guidance or refer the patient to appropriate cessation services.
Alcohol and Men's Health
Regular alcohol consumption can affect:
- Liver health
- Blood pressure
- Sleep
- Weight
- Mental well-being
- Medication effectiveness
Be honest about alcohol intake during your consultation so the doctor can provide appropriate advice.

When Should You Seek Medical Care?
A routine men's health checkup should not replace urgent medical care.
Seek prompt medical attention for symptoms such as:
- Chest pain
- Severe difficulty breathing
- Fainting
- Sudden weakness
- Blood in urine
- Severe testicular pain
- Sudden neurological symptoms
- Severe abdominal pain
These symptoms may require immediate assessment.
